Real-World Application: The Custom Sweatshirt Test

To truly evaluate this asset, I mentally placed it in a real-life production scenario. Imagine a client requests a personalized gift for her mother who just retired from thirty years of nursing. She wants a crewneck sweatshirt, not just a t-shirt. This is where the Retired Nurse Happier Nurse Mom T-Shirt graphic faces its biggest test. Sweatshirt fleece has a high pile and texture that can swallow fine details. If this design relies heavily on thin running stitch lettering or intricate shading, it will disappear into the fabric texture.

In this scenario, I would recommend treating this as an applique design or modifying the digitization to include a thicker underlay. If you are using this as a direct embroidery file, ensure the satin stitch columns are wide enough to cover the fleece nap. Conversely, if you are using this graphic for heat transfer vinyl or sublimation on a smooth polyester shirt, the detail retention will be much higher. For those of us running a craft business, understanding this distinction prevents customer complaints about "messy" looking embroidery. The design’s layout appears centered and balanced, making it ideal for left-chest placement on a polo or full-center placement on a holiday embroidery project like a family reunion shirt.

Navigating Fabric Challenges and Hoop Sizes

While the design is versatile, there are specific environments where caution is necessary. I always advise testing on scrap fabric first, especially when working with stretchy knits common in custom apparel. The tension required to stabilize a t-shirt can distort the design if the stabilizer choice is incorrect. For this specific artwork, a cut-away stabilizer is non-negotiable to prevent the "Happier Nurse Mom" text from warping after washing.

You must also consider hoop size limitations. Before purchasing or downloading this digital embroidery file, confirm the dimensions against your machine’s capabilities. If the design includes decorative flourishes around the text, cropping them out to fit a smaller 4x4 hoop might ruin the composition. Additionally, be wary of using this on dark fabrics unless the file includes a white underlay or knockdown stitch. Without it, the thread colors may blend into a black or navy shirt, reducing contrast and readability. For baby embroidery or items needing frequent washing, verify that the stitch density isn't too high, as dense patches can make lightweight fabrics stiff and uncomfortable.
